Box Score ELON, N.C. - Elon scored three times in the first half as Campbell's late surge fell short in a 3-2 defeat Saturday night at Rudd Field.
Campbell falls to 2-5-4 and 1-3-2 in CAA play while the Phoenix improve to 2-7-3 and 1-3-2 in league play.
Elon scored the opening goal in the 5th minute on a right footed shot from Calle Edelstam just outside the 18 yard box. Campbell leveled the game just 1:36 later as Tai-Reece Chisholm scored off a deflected shot from Teva Lossec.
Scott Vatne put the Phoenix ahead again in the 17th minute on an assist from Victor Stromsen while Jack Dolk added another in the 34th minute off an Isak Sedin assist.
Adrien Gameiro hit the top of the crossbar on a deep shot fired from roughly 30 yards out in the 52nd minute. Tiago Lopes, making his season debut off the bench, had another attempt on goal as his header off a corner was saved in the 65th minute.
In the 84th minute, in the midst of a sudden downpour, Campbell found the back of the net when Lopes' header off a deep throw-in was deflected back in front of the net for Chisholm who headed it in for his second goal of the night.
The Phoenix held a 14-10 advantage in shots but the Camels had a 7-6 edge in attempts on frame.
